As of April 8, 2026, GAMCO Global Gold Natural Resources & Income Trust (GGN) is trading at $5.47, marking a 1.07% gain in the most recent trading session. This analysis examines key technical levels for the closed-end fund, which focuses on gold, natural resource assets, and income generation for shareholders, alongside broader market context that may influence near-term price action.
